Qatar Airways Privilege Club Pro: A New Take on Travel Loyalty

Qatar Airways has launched a new subscription service for its Privilege Club members. The Privilege Club Pro program aims to improve the travel experience, allowing members to earn more Avios and Qpoints each month. This subscription model aims to change loyalty programs, helping travelers accumulate status points.

Subscription Tiers and Benefits

The Privilege Club Pro subscription is designed for different types of travelers, from those just starting out to frequent flyers looking for better benefits. There are four membership tiers, each with its own advantages, including a monthly boost of Avios for flight tickets, upgrades, and experiences. These rewards can really enhance a trip.

Access Tier

This entry-level tier costs $50 a month or $500 a year and gives you 2,500 Avios each month. It's a good starting point for learning how to collect Avios and earn rewards.

Select Tier

At $130 a month ($1,300 a year), members earn 7,500 Avios per month. It's good for those who want to get more Avios without spending too much more.

Exclusive Tier

This tier costs $240 a month or $2,400 a year and offers 15,000 Avios each month. If you want to build up your Avios balance, this tier can help you reach your travel goals faster.

Ultimate Tier

The top tier costs $350 a month or $3,500 a year. Members earn 20,000 Avios and 5 Qpoints per month, which can help them reach Silver, Gold, or Platinum status faster. This tier can really speed up Avios collection and status recognition.

Qpoints and Membership Levels

Qpoints are important for Qatar Airways loyalty program members because they determine how you move through the status levels. For example, going from Burgundy to Silver requires 150 Qpoints, while upgrading from Gold to Platinum requires 600 Qpoints. The Ultimate Tier gives you more Qpoints, so you can reach higher statuses more quickly.

Qpoints Requirements for Status Levels

  • Burgundy to Silver: 150 Qpoints
  • Silver to Gold: 300 Qpoints
  • Gold to Platinum: 600 Qpoints

Each new tier unlocks benefits like priority boarding, more baggage allowance, and lounge access.

More Ways to Earn Rewards

The Privilege Club Pro program offers more than just flight benefits. Members can enjoy exclusive, personalized experiences, such as shopping masterclasses and attending major sporting events. This is what sets the program apart from typical frequent flyer programs.

Privilege Club Collection

Members can access unique auction experiences, from the FIFA World Cup 2026 to the UEFA Champions League. These experiences are hard to get and can make your trip memorable.

Qatar Duty Free Benefits

Privilege Club Pro members can use their Avios at Qatar Duty Free in Hamad International Airport and other locations. They can shop for luxury products, electronics, and more, showing how many benefits the program offers.

Award Seat Flights

Members can also use their Avios for flights across a network of over 160 destinations. This flexibility helps travelers manage their travel costs.

Joining the Program

If you're interested in joining the Privilege Club Pro, you can sign up on the Qatar Airways website or mobile app. You can choose between monthly or annual subscriptions to fit your travel needs. Members can also cancel their subscriptions at any time.
